Abstract :
The paper describes the design and the Java implementation of a coordination architecture for mobile agents, based on an object oriented Linda-like tuple space model, compliant with the Sun´s JavaSpaces specifications. Moreover, unlike Linda and JavaSpaces, the proposed architecture integrates a reactive model: the behaviour of the tuple spaces can be programmed by installing reactions which are triggered by the accesses of mobile agents to the tuple spaces. Reactions can increase the coordination flexibility and ease agent programming as shown via an application example in the network management area
